Understanding the Bail Process



The Bail process represents a crucial intersection of justice and specific legal rights, permitting defendants the possibility to protect their release from safekeeping while awaiting trial. This process begins when an individual is arrested, and a court establishes the Bail amount based on different factors, consisting of the severity of the claimed criminal offense and the offender's trip threat. Accuseds or their representatives can then approach bail bond services to aid in safeguarding the required funds. It is very important to comprehend that Bail is not a decision of sense of guilt yet a means to guarantee the charged's presence at future court process. Successful navigating of this process can have significant effects on the offender's life, influencing their capability to prepare a protection and keep professional and personal responsibilities.


Kinds Of Bail Bonds Available

Various sorts of Bail bonds are available to meet the certain demands of offenders and their families throughout the Bail procedure. One of the most common type is the surety bond, where a bail agent guarantees the complete Bail quantity to the court for a charge. Money bonds require the complete Bail quantity to be paid in money, while building bonds include utilizing genuine estate as security. Federal bonds put on government instances and commonly involve a lot more intricate needs. Migration bonds are especially for individuals apprehended by immigration authorities. Each type of bail bond offers different situations, allowing accuseds to safeguard their launch while waiting for test, guaranteeing they can continue their every day lives and plan for their court hearings.

Co-Signer Responsibilities and Options



Co-signers play an important function in the bail bond procedure, offering monetary assurance to the bail bond agent. Their key duty is to assure the complete Bail quantity in case the defendant fails to show up in court. This commitment means that co-signers must have check out here a secure revenue, good credit report background, and a clear understanding of the economic threats included. In addition, co-signers are typically needed to give collateral, such as building or cash money, to protect the bail bond. They likewise maintain communication with the bail bond representative, making certain that all problems of the bond are met. Ultimately, co-signers must evaluate their options meticulously, as their economic security might be at stake if the accused does not accomplish their lawful obligations.

What Occurs if the Accused Breaches Bail Conditions?



If the accused goes against Bail problems, repercussions may consist of revocation of Bail, arrest, and possible added fees. The court may also impose stricter problems or raise the Bail quantity for future release chances.
